Murtra Nonwovens is a participant in the United Nations Global Compact and is firmly committed to upholding its Ten Principles and contributing to the Sustainable Development Goals. This commitment is renewed and reflected each year in the Communication on Progress (CoP), a document outlining the company’s actions and progress achieved.
More than 15,000 companies from 162 countries are affiliated with the United Nations Global Compact: it is the world’s largest corporate sustainability initiative. Its goal is to set a strategy of best practices in the areas of human rights, labor, environment, and anti-corruption.
